Generally, a lot of private and public establishment are yet to recognize the impact of computer in materials management in their various company Lysons (1981: 56 – 57) other includes;
1 There is always high cost of money and effort in installing a computerization system which may produce similar companies from adopting this type of system.
2 It is always difficult to correct errors when they occur e.g. when the wrong number is entered on a computer transaction.
3 It is not as flexible as a manual procedures once a computer ha been programmed the routine of operation must be followed since deviations will lead to confusion and mistake.
4 A major breakdown in the computer system could cause choose in the system and in the company’s operational activities.
5 The application of computers system reduces the numbers of staff. This reduction in number of staff results to unemployment and is a big problem particularly in developing companies.
6 Computer systems are only as good as the staff operating them and the data processed and fed into the computer. Badly trained staff or faulty documentation will not be solved by the application of computers in materials management.

Impact Of Computer In Materials Management::

Computers have had a significant impact on materials management in various industries. Materials management involves the planning, organizing, and controlling of materials, from their acquisition to their utilization and disposal. Computers have revolutionized this field by improving efficiency, accuracy, and decision-making. Here are some key ways computers have influenced materials management:

Inventory Management: Computers have greatly improved inventory control and optimization. Advanced software can track inventory levels in real-time, calculate reorder points, and generate purchase orders automatically when stock levels fall below a certain threshold. This reduces the risk of stockouts and excess inventory, leading to cost savings and improved customer service.

Demand Forecasting: Computerized forecasting models can analyze historical data and market trends to predict future demand for materials more accurately. This helps organizations plan their procurement and production schedules effectively, reducing the risk of overstocking or understocking.

Supplier Management: Computers enable organizations to manage their relationships with suppliers more efficiently. Supplier databases, communication tools, and performance tracking systems help in selecting the right suppliers, negotiating contracts, and ensuring timely deliveries.

Quality Control: Computer-aided quality control systems can monitor the quality of materials and products throughout the supply chain. These systems use sensors and data analysis to detect defects and deviations from quality standards, reducing waste and ensuring consistent product quality.

Warehouse Management: Warehouse management systems (WMS) powered by computers enhance the efficiency of materials handling, storage, and retrieval. They provide real-time visibility into inventory levels and the location of materials within the warehouse, streamlining order fulfillment processes.

Cost Reduction: Computers allow for better cost tracking and cost reduction strategies. Materials managers can use software to analyze costs associated with procurement, transportation, storage, and handling, identifying areas where cost-saving measures can be implemented.

Data Analytics: Big data analytics and data mining techniques enable materials managers to gain valuable insights from large datasets. They can identify trends, spot anomalies, and make data-driven decisions to optimize materials management strategies.

Risk Management: Computers can help identify and mitigate risks in the materials supply chain. This includes tracking geopolitical, economic, and environmental factors that may affect the availability and cost of materials.

Sustainability: With increased emphasis on sustainability, computers are used to track and manage eco-friendly materials, assess the environmental impact of the supply chain, and make decisions that align with sustainability goals.

Communication and Collaboration: Computers facilitate communication and collaboration among teams responsible for materials management. Cloud-based systems and collaborative tools enable real-time sharing of information and coordination among various departments involved in the process.

Compliance and Regulations: Computers help organizations stay compliant with regulatory requirements related to materials management. They can track and document compliance with safety, environmental, and reporting standards.

In summary, computers have transformed materials management by enhancing efficiency, accuracy, and decision-making capabilities. They have enabled organizations to optimize their supply chains, reduce costs, improve quality, and better adapt to changing market conditions. As technology continues to advance, the impact of computers on materials management will likely continue to evolve and expand.
